The Barstow Unified Union School District #49 in Vermont has only one elementary school, Barstow Memorial School, which serves students from pre-kindergarten through 8th grade. The school's performance has fluctuated in recent years, with its statewide ranking ranging from 18th out of 113 Vermont elementary schools in 2022-2023 to 81st out of 137 in 2024-2025.
Academically, Barstow Memorial School's 5th-grade students performed better than the state average in English Language Arts but worse in Mathematics. However, the school's 8th-grade students excelled in Science, outperforming the state average by a significant margin. The school also faces challenges with a chronic absenteeism rate of 12.4%, which can impact student learning and achievement. Additionally, the school serves a population with relatively lower socioeconomic status, with 24.4% of students eligible for free or reduced-price lunch.
Despite these mixed results, Barstow Memorial School's per-student spending of $11,220 and a student-teacher ratio of 9.6 to 1 suggest that the school is investing resources to support its students.
